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66530939622 55733070 4907943 09023
9359404008 7175661
9359404008 7175661
0443 6016 176006
All about undefined
Interested in learning more?
9359404008 7175661
0443 6016 176006
See more
370 6288637902 8761
0886488 6339 0868
See more
569794190 762061429
344236 0428584970 63320951350 73464
See more